How to effectively extend the service life of medical refrigerators?

How to effectively extend the service life of medical refrigerators?


Medical refrigerators are indispensable equipment in medical institutions, used to store temperature sensitive items such as drugs, vaccines, blood samples, etc. Due to its importance, extending the service life of medical refrigerators can not only reduce equipment replacement costs, but also ensure the safety and effectiveness of medical supplies. The following are some effective methods to extend the service life of medical refrigerators, covering daily maintenance, operating standards, environmental management, and other aspects.


---


1、 Daily maintenance and upkeep


1. Regular cleaning


The interior and exterior of medical refrigerators should be regularly cleaned to avoid the accumulation of dust and dirt. When cleaning, use mild cleaning agents and soft cloths, and avoid using corrosive chemicals to prevent damage to the surface or internal components of the box. Pay special attention to cleaning the condenser and radiator to ensure good ventilation.


2. Check the sealing strip


The door seal is a key component for maintaining temperature stability in refrigerated containers. Regularly inspect the sealing strip for aging, damage, or looseness, and replace it promptly if there are any issues. When cleaning the sealing strip, it can be wiped with warm water and a soft cloth to avoid scratching with sharp objects.


3. Clean the drainage holes


There are usually drainage holes inside the refrigerator for draining condensed water. Regularly inspect and clean the drainage holes to prevent blockages and prevent water accumulation from causing internal humidity rise or equipment failure.


4. Check the compressor and condenser


The compressor and condenser are the core components of a refrigerated container. Regularly check its working status to ensure no abnormal noise or vibration. If the compressor overheats or the condenser has poor heat dissipation, the cause should be promptly investigated and resolved.


---


2、 Standardized operation and use


1. Avoid frequent opening and closing of doors


Frequent opening and closing of doors can cause temperature fluctuations inside the box, increase the workload of the compressor, and accelerate equipment aging. When using, try to minimize the number and time of door openings, and if necessary, plan the order of item access.


2. Reasonably place items


Items should be placed reasonably according to the design requirements of the refrigerator to avoid blocking the air vents or affecting air circulation. At the same time, there should be a certain gap between items to ensure even distribution of cold air.


3. Avoid overloading operation


The capacity of a refrigerated container is limited, and overloading can increase the burden on the compressor, leading to equipment overheating or damage. Items should be stored reasonably according to the rated capacity of the refrigerator.


4. Set the temperature correctly


According to the requirements for storing items, set the temperature of the refrigerator within a reasonable range to avoid setting the temperature too low or too high. Too low a temperature can increase energy consumption and burden on the compressor, while too high a temperature may affect the safety of stored items.


---


3、 Environmental Management and Optimization


1. Choose the appropriate installation location


The refrigerator should be placed in a well ventilated area away from heat sources and direct sunlight. Ensure there is sufficient space around the device for the radiator to function properly. Avoid placing refrigerated containers in damp or dusty environments.


2. Maintain stable environmental temperature


Excessive or insufficient ambient temperature can affect the performance of refrigerated containers. It is recommended to place the refrigerator in an environment with suitable room temperature to avoid extreme temperature conditions.


3. Avoid vibration and impact


The refrigerator should be placed on a stable ground to avoid vibration or impact. Vibration may cause internal components to loosen or be damaged, affecting the normal operation of the equipment.


---


4、 Regular inspection and maintenance


1. Regularly calibrate the temperature


The temperature control system of the refrigerator needs to be calibrated regularly to ensure the accuracy of temperature display. Professional thermometers can be used for comparative testing, and any deviations can be adjusted in a timely manner.


2. Regularly check the power supply and circuit


Check if the power cord is aging or damaged to ensure stable circuit connection. If any problems are found with the power cord or socket, they should be replaced or repaired in a timely manner to avoid equipment damage caused by circuit problems.


3. Timely handle faults


If there are abnormal noises, unstable temperatures, or inability to start the refrigerator, professional personnel should be contacted in a timely manner for maintenance to avoid small problems escalating into major malfunctions.


---


5、 Reasonably use backup equipment


1. Configure a backup refrigerated container


For institutions storing critical medical supplies, it is recommended to equip them with backup refrigerated containers. When the main equipment fails, the backup equipment can ensure the safe storage of materials and buy time for the maintenance of the main equipment.


2. Rotating the use of equipment


If there are multiple refrigerated containers, they can be rotated regularly to avoid long-term high load operation of a single device, thereby extending the overall service life of the equipment.


---


6、 Training and Education


1. Operator training


Provide professional training to operators who use refrigerated containers, enabling them to master the correct usage methods and maintenance skills, and avoid equipment damage caused by improper operation.


2. Develop a maintenance plan


Develop a detailed maintenance plan, clarify the frequency and content of cleaning, inspection, and repair, and designate a dedicated person to execute it to ensure that maintenance work is implemented effectively.


---


conclusion


The service life of medical refrigerators is closely related to factors such as daily maintenance, operating standards, and environmental management. By regularly cleaning, standardizing operations, optimizing the environment, conducting regular inspections, and using backup equipment reasonably, the service life of refrigerated containers can be effectively extended, equipment replacement costs can be reduced, and the safety and effectiveness of medical supplies can be ensured. Medical institutions should attach great importance to the maintenance and management of refrigerated containers, providing reliable equipment support for medical work.
